安装 MySQL
获取 MySQL 镜像
docker pull mysql:5.7
创建并运行 MySQL 服务
docker run --name mysql-server -v /Users/zhaodaojun/Documents/data/mysql/data:/var/lib/mysql \
-v /Users/zhaodaojun/Documents/data/mysql/conf:/etc/mysql/conf.d \
-e MYSQL_ROOT_PASSWORD=pass -p 127.0.0.1:3306:3306 -d mysql:5.7
使用宿主机的数据及配置目录,挂在到容器中
查看服务 IP
docker inspect mysql-server | grep IPAddress
创建并运行 MySQL 客户端
docker run -it -v /Users/zhaodaojun/Downloads:/data --rm mysql:5.7 mysql -h 172.17.0.2 -u root -p